Accompany a master woodcarving teacher as he reveals the secrets of his art--and build skills, confidence, and creativity. Decorative woodcarving brings ornamentation, depth, and pattern to a simple piece of wood. For everything from a wall plaque to furniture; the chisel or mallet equals the painter's brush. For the beginning carver, there's no more authoritative guide to tools, techniques, materials, and safety procedures than this complete course. Start with a Three Tear Drops design that provides a lesson in using the skew chisel. Progress to a Renaissance Style Leaf; a reproduction of a Colonial door panel; and repeating patterns. Carve pediments; lettering; a Jacobean cartouche; rolled scrolls; and more. Dozens of photographs--many taken in class--illustrate the right and the wrong way to proceed when picking up a chisel, knife, or mallet; making cuts; and carrying out a project. From drawing a design to completing a decoratively carved mirror, every detail is covered! 160 pages (all in color), 8 1/2 x 10.
